Tracey Killeen is in the driver's seat

Tracey Killeen
Apr 15, 2010 Updated Apr 21, 2010

Australian singer-songwriter Tracey Killeen is gearing up to release her second album, 'Drivers Seat', in May.

The first single 'Brave', written by Tamara Stewart and Jenny Landis, is out now and is about having the strength and courage to face life's obstacles.

"The song is really poignant to me" said Tracy. "I felt that anyone can relate to it. Every day millions of people all over the planet dig deep inside themselves and take the leap. It seems that the biggest fear for so many people is simply taking the first step. The major step of being brave and moving on with life."

Killeen will be touring through Queensland and New South Wales, in support of the album, with one date in the Northern Territory at the Katherine Country Music Muster.

The album will be launched officially at Rooty Hill RSL in Sydney, on May 20.
